My grandmother was German, but never spoke it due to a lot of the stigma which came after WW2 when she moved to England - people in the street saying she'd murdered their family members etc. I learnt French and Russian at school, so came here knowing only a few words.

The amazing thing is the number of people who want to speak English to me, and who apologize for their language when it's actually excellent. It's been the attititude of the locals and co-workers here that have made it so much easier for me. Between them and the job (which I love), I haven't been left feeling alone or homesick.

That's not to say I don't miss things about home, and it's one reason I'm grateful to have CorsaSport, the world seems less daunting when you have a link to your home country like this.
